WebMar 1, 1997 · In our previous work [8], we studied the effect of the Cu, Ni, and Zn complexes with GnRH on the release of LH and FSH in vivo. The complex of Cu2 with GnRH brought about a high release of LH and an even higher release of FSH. The nickel complex showed a similar although lesser effect. Zinc complex had the same po- tency as native GnRtt. WebThis gene encodes the receptor for type 1 gonadotropin-releasing hormone. This receptor is a member of the seven-transmembrane, G-protein coupled receptor (GPCR) family. It is expressed on the surface of pituitary gonadotrope cells as well as lymphocytes, breast, ovary, and prostate. Following binding of gonadotropin-releasing hormone, the receptor …
